Role Summary/Purpose:
As a member of the Growth Governance & Excellence organization, the AVP, Marketing Fair Lending Tollgate Manager is responsible for executing various quality and oversight routines to strengthen the first line of defense risk management framework within Growth. Reporting to the VP, New Product Introduction and Change Strategy, the AVP, Marketing Fair Lending Tollgate Manager will support various governance and oversight activities and lead the Marketing Fair Lending governance and tollgate activities in connection with the Fair Lending requirements set forth by the SYB R-700 Fair Lending Policy and the R-S700.5 Fair Lending of Consumer Segmentation Tools Standard. This individual must be a strong communicator, work effectively in a matrixed environment, able to think both strategically and tactically, and embrace a culture of change and innovation.

Essential Responsibilities:
Perform, document, and retain evidence of Marketing Fair Lending tollgate activities in support of a Synchrony wide view of Fair Lending activities
Facilitate weekly tasks related to tollage meetings including creating agendas, collecting materials, and keeping/maintaining minutes, leading and facilitating weekly meetings to ensure appropriate risk oversight and management of consumer segmentation tools, models, and other tools that meet the tollgate requirements
Maintain the Customer Segmentation Tool (CST) and Non Model Tool (NMT) quarterly management and attestation
Manage Suppression Repository activities including management of Synchrony Standard and Standard Plus Suppression Repository, facilitate periodic review of suppressions and collaborate with stakeholders to circulate revisions
Support L3 Process owner activities including periodic refresh of the RAQ, PRC and PRCSA documents, issue resolution and remediation related to Marketing Fair Lending Tollgate, when necessary
Support compliant execution of the Marketing Fair Lending Tollgate process in accordance with applicable policies and procedures
Design and deliver regular and ad hoc training to key stakeholders
Develop and perform controls to ensure complete and accurate tollgate activities are properly mitigating risk
Identify opportunities to streamline and enhance the Marketing Fair Lending Tollgate process through workflow automation and reporting in partnership with the Workfront team to lead the development and implementation of enhancements into the Workfront workstream
Work with key stakeholders in Marketing, campaign execution, client teams, second line of defense fair lending leaders, product owners, and other business leaders to ensure compliant, timely, and effective routines in Fair Lending, and other quality and oversight activities
Collaborate with Change Governance COE and other tollgates throughout the company to ensure risks and controls are properly identified as part of the Company’s Change Governance process
Ensure significant risks are promptly escalated to the appropriate level through the prescribed protocol
Introduce into the business effective tools, systems, and controls for analyzing and monitoring applicable regulatory risks
As team roles and responsibilities expand and change over time, incorporate new quality, oversight, or governance routines and activities into ongoing operating rhythm
Perform other duties and/or special projects as assigned
